EM-1048
Message
Probable cause
The I2C bus problems have been resolved and I2C access to the FRU has become available again.
The FRU-Id value is composed of a FRU-type string and an optional number to identify the unit, slot, or
port. The FRU-Id value can be:
• Switch for fixed port count switches.
• Slot 1 through Slot 10 for the Core Switch 2/64 and SAN Director 2/128.
• PS 1 through PS 4 (power supplies) for the Core Switch 2/64 and SAN Director 2/128, or PS 1
through PS 2 for the SAN Switch 2/32 and SAN Switch 4/32. The power supplies on the SAN Switch
2/8V and the SAN Switch 2/16V are not field replaceable.
• Fan 1 through Fan 3 for the Core Switch 2/64, SAN Director 2/128, and SAN Switch 4/32 (six
fans in three FRUs). Fan 1 through Fan 6 for the SAN Switch 2/32 (six fans in three FRUs). The fans
on the SAN Switch 2/8V and the SAN Switch 2/16V are not field replaceable.
• WWN 1 or WWN 2 for the Core Switch 2/64 and SAN Director 2/128. Only bladed switches have
removable WWN cards. All other switches have a non-removable WWN component on the main
logic board.
The SAN Switch 2/8V has one power supply and three fans, and the SAN Switch 2/16V has two power
supplies and four fans. Values for the individual fans and power supplies for these switches may appear,
but these parts cannot be replaced. The switch itself is a FRU.
Recommended action
The EM-1029 error can be a transitory error; if the problem resolves, the EM-1048 message is displayed.
Severity
INFO
